BRIDGES OF MADISON COUNTY Tour Stars Elizabeth Stanley and Andrew Samonsky Will Give Preview at Madison County Covered Bridge Festival

By: Oct. 06, 2015

Des Moines Performing Arts, in partnership with THE BRIDGES OF MADISON COUNTY national tour and the Madison County Chamber of Commerce, will host two special guests this weekend in Iowa's covered bridge capital. On Saturday, October 10, Elizabeth Stanley and Andrew Samonsky, who will star as Francesca Johnson and Robert Kincaid in THE BRIDGES OF MADISON COUNTY's upcoming national tour, will perform selections from the musical at the 46th Annual Madison County Covered Bridge Festival in Winterset, Iowa at 2 p.m. The performance will take place on the Mel Penrod Stage, located on the south side of the Iowa Courthouse Square. THE BRIDGES OF MADISON COUNTY, winner of the 2014 Tony Award for Best Original Score and Best Orchestrations, is famously set in Iowa and will launch its national tour at the Des Moines Civic Center November 28 - December 5.

Ms. Stanley and Mr. Samonsky will perform THE BRIDGES OF MADISON COUNTY's "To Build a Home," "Before and After You / One Second and a Million Miles," and "It All Fades Away." The critically acclaimed musical features one of Broadway's most accomplished creative teams with music and lyrics by three-time Tony Award®-winning composer JASON ROBERT BROWN (Parade, The Last Five Years), book by Pulitzer Prize-winning writer MARSHA NORMAN (The Secret Garden, The Color Purple, 'night, Mother), and direction by Tony Award®-winner BARTLETT SHER (South Pacific, The King and I, The Light in the Piazza), recreated by TYNE RAFAELI.

The team also includes scenic design by two-time Tony Award®-winner MICHAEL YEARGAN (The Light in the Piazza, South Pacific), costume design by six-time Tony Award®-winner CATHERINE ZUBER (South Pacific, The Light in the Piazza, The Coast of Utopia), lighting design by two-time Tony Award®-winner DONALD HOLDER (South Pacific, The Lion King), sound design by JON WESTON, arrangements and orchestrations by JASON ROBERT BROWN, movement by DANNY MEFFORD, and casting by TELSEY + COMPANY/CESAR ROCHA, CSA.

Based on the best-selling novel by ROBERT JAMES WALLER, THE BRIDGES OF MADISON COUNTY tells the story of Iowa housewife Francesca Johnson and her life-changing, four-day whirlwind romance with traveling photographer Robert Kincaid. It's an unforgettable story of two people caught between decision and desire, as a chance encounter becomes a second chance at so much more.

The Original Broadway Cast Recording of THE BRIDGES OF MADISON COUNTY, now available on Ghostlight Records, was released on April 15, 2014 and debuted as the #1 Cast Recording on the Billboard charts. THE BRIDGES OF MADISON COUNTY national tour will launch at the Des Moines Civic Center with performances beginning Saturday, November 28th and an official opening on Tuesday, December 1st. The tour will travel to more than 15 cities in its first season.
